Definition and Functionality

DSPs are software platforms that enable advertisers to buy digital ad space in real-time. They aggregate multiple ad exchanges, providing access to a vast inventory of display, video, and mobile ads. Advertisers can set specific targeting criteria, such as demographics, interests, and behaviors. This precision ensures that ads reach the desired audience, enhancing engagement and conversion rates.

DSPs function through algorithms that analyze user data, determine the value of impressions, and execute transactions on behalf of advertisers. They allow for programmatic buying, which automates ad purchases, streamlining the process and improving efficiency. Features like reporting dashboards offer advertisers insights into campaign performance, thus facilitating strategic adjustments.

Real-Time Bidding Capabilities

Real-time bidding (RTB) capabilities allow advertisers to purchase ad inventory in real-time through automated auctions. Advertisers set bid amounts based on the value they assign to specific impressions. RTB enables advertisers to access millions of potential ad placements instantly, ensuring they display ads to the most relevant audiences at the right time. With sophisticated algorithms, DSPs evaluate user data to make informed bidding decisions, optimizing ad spend while minimizing waste.

Targeting and Segmentation Tools

Targeting and segmentation tools within DSPs enable advertisers to define their audience meticulously. Advertisers can segment audiences based on demographics, interests, behaviors, and geographic locations. This granular targeting ensures that ad messages resonate with the intended audience, improving engagement and conversion rates. Layering multiple targeting options, such as retargeting previous visitors or focusing on high-value users, enhances campaign performance and drives tailored marketing efforts.

Challenges in Media Buying Demand-Side Platforms

Media buying through demand-side platforms (DSPs) presents unique challenges that advertisers must navigate. Understanding these obstacles is crucial for maximizing the effectiveness of ad campaigns.

Data Privacy Concerns

Data privacy concerns significantly impact media buying. Advertisers face stricter regulations, such as GDPR and CCPA, which mandate transparency in data usage. Failure to comply can lead to hefty fines and reputational damage. Moreover, the reduction of third-party cookies limits the ability to track user behavior effectively. I must adapt to these restrictions by focusing on first-party data and ensuring transparency in data practices. Implementing robust data management strategies becomes essential for maintaining audience targeting precision while complying with regulations.

Ad Fraud Issues

Ad fraud issues pose substantial threats in the digital advertising landscape. Fraudsters exploit vulnerabilities in DSP systems, leading to inflated metrics and wasted ad spend. I encounter challenges such as click fraud, impression fraud, and bot traffic, which distort campaign performance. Utilizing advanced verification tools can mitigate these risks. Partnering with reputable ad verification companies ensures the integrity of ad placements, thereby enhancing ROI. A proactive approach to combating ad fraud is necessary for maintaining campaign efficacy and trust in DSPs.
